零基础到精通:Unix系统构建学习与实践全指南

Unix系统构建是一个从零开始逐步深入的过程,涉及操作系统原理、命令行操作、系统配置和网络管理等多个方面。对于初学者来说,理解Unix的基本概念是第一步。

学习Unix可以从安装一个Unix-like系统开始,比如Linux发行版或macOS。这些系统提供了与Unix相似的环境,便于实践操作。熟悉终端命令是关键,如ls、cd、grep等基础命令。

AI绘图结果,仅供参考

随着对命令行的熟练,可以进一步学习Shell脚本编程,通过编写脚本来自动化日常任务。这不仅能提高效率,还能加深对系统运行机制的理解。

系统管理知识同样重要,包括用户权限管理、进程控制、文件系统结构等。了解这些内容有助于维护系统的稳定性和安全性。

网络配置和防火墙设置也是Unix系统构建的一部分。掌握TCP/IP协议、SSH连接和网络服务配置,能帮助搭建可靠的服务器环境。

实践是提升技能的最佳方式。可以通过搭建个人服务器、参与开源项目或进行系统调试来积累经验。不断尝试和解决问题,才能真正掌握Unix系统构建。

dawei

【声明】:达州站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复